San Francisco police Friday were searching for a man who attacked teenage girl and her mother on a crowded Muni bus.
According to police, the attack took place last weekend when a man boarded a crowded Muni bus at Mission and Onondaga Ave.
The man – standing 6-2, balding and wearing a black sweatshirt – began to push his way through the crowded aisle when the teenage girl shoved him back and yelled at him. The two got into a confrontation during which the man punched the teenager and then started to strangle her.
The girl’s mother stepped in to stop the assault but was also punched before the man fled the bus.
